Solutions Consultant
Description
We want to be transparent about this role from the start. This position is highly visible, client-facing, and requires real commitment. You will engage directly with executive-level stakeholders, including directors, judges, VPs, and senior leadership. Success in this role requires balancing significant preparation time, extensive travel, and shifting deadlines driven by sales demand. If you thrive on ownership, preparation, and performing in front of others, this role will be a strong fit.
Responsibilities
• Travel extensively to support onsite demonstrations, conferences, trade shows, and client meetings. Current travel expectations range from approximately 50 to 75 percent, depending on sales demand.
• Deliver consultative product demonstrations of the Inmate Services platform to prospective and existing clients in both remote and onsite settings.
• Prepare and configure demo environments aligned to client discovery, operational workflows, and RFP requirements.
• Operate in a deadline-driven sales environment where priorities shift, and timelines are not self-selected.
• Lead client discussions by asking targeted questions, identifying decision makers, and aligning product capabilities to real operational challenges.
• Adapt quickly during live demonstrations and adjust presentation strategy in real time based on audience engagement and feedback.
• Manage workload independently with limited day-to-day oversight and maintain readiness for short-notice requests.
• Maintain a strong working knowledge of product functionality and collaborate cross-functionally to ensure accurate solution positioning.
Qualifications
• Experience delivering live software demonstrations or presenting complex solutions in front of external stakeholders.
• Ability to perform effectively in high-visibility, client-facing situations.
• Strong time management skills and the ability to balance multiple deadlines simultaneously.
• Demonstrated self-direction and accountability in roles with significant autonomy.
• Comfort engaging with executive-level leadership and responding professionally to direct feedback or scrutiny.
• Strong written communication skills to support RFP responses and technical validation.
• Willingness and ability to travel up to 50 to 75 percent as required.
